Understanding the Primary Uses of a Data Lake

Data lakes are essential for managing vast amounts of raw data until it's ready for analysis. Perfect for businesses looking to harness diverse datasets, they streamline accessibility and exploration of information. Embrace the flexibility of data lakes and discover how they differ from traditional data management systems.

Unraveling the Mystery of Data Lakes: What You Need to Know

So, you’ve heard the term “data lake” floating around in the tech space, right? Maybe you’ve come across it in class, during discussions with peers, or even in an article while trying to grasp the enormity of data management in today’s world. But what exactly is a data lake, and why are companies so enthusiastic about keeping one? Let’s dive into the heart of it all and explore just how these vast storage repositories fit into the bigger picture of data management.

What Is a Data Lake, Anyway?

In the simplest terms, a data lake is like a massive reservoir for unprocessed data. Imagine a gigantic pool filled with everything from social media posts and sensor data from IoT devices to user logs from your favorite apps. Unlike traditional databases that typically require structured, neatly organized data (think of it like a tidy filing cabinet), data lakes are more flexible. They let you store different types of data in their original forms without forcing you to follow a specific format or schema. This flexibility is one of the key reasons why businesses are becoming increasingly interested in leveraging data lakes.

Now, you might wonder, why would anyone want to store raw data? Well, think about how fast-paced our world is today—having the flexibility to save loads of data as it comes in means you can retrieve it down the line for deeper insights. Picture a detective confidently pulling out a box of unsorted evidence—no, it’s not disorganized chaos; it’s potential waiting to reveal the truth.

The Bread and Butter of a Data Lake

When it comes to the core function of a data lake, the main goal is to hold large amounts of raw data until it’s needed. Simple enough, right? This way, organizations can keep a treasure trove of data that can later be analyzed to generate real insights.

This brings us to the key benefits of having a data lake:

  • Scalability: Data lakes can store astronomical amounts of data. Think of it as an ever-expanding library where you never run out of shelf space.

  • Variety: You can store unstructured, semi-structured, and structured data. From text files and audio recordings to databases controlling your website's functionality—everything can find a home in a data lake.

  • Exploratory Data Analysis: Users can play around with the raw data without having to conform to the rigid structure of standard databases. It’s like having the freedom to explore a vast forest rather than navigating along a prescribed path.

Beyond Just Storage

Now, here’s an interesting twist: while a data lake excels at holding data, it doesn’t quite serve as a tool for generating real-time analytics. You might think, "But isn't that what data lakes are for?" Well, not exactly. Tasks like generating instantaneous analytical insights or managing transactional data are typically the territory of data warehouses or specialized analytical tools.

For example, if data lakes are spacious libraries allowing for exploration, data warehouses are more like formal reading rooms where you take structured information and conduct specific studies or reports. The boundary is clear – those interested in immediate analytics and reporting will find comfort in data warehouses.

So, What's In It for Businesses?

The real question is: how can businesses benefit from this flexible and accommodating data storage solution? Say you're a company looking to leverage your customer data to improve engagement and understand behavior trends. With a data lake in place, you can store interaction logs, customer feedback, survey results, and social media sentiments all in one vast space. When it's time to analyze this data to make informed decisions? You’ve got access to raw information galore!

Moreover, think about companies harnessing the power of Machine Learning and AI. They thrive on vast datasets, and data lakes can provide constant access to the kind of diverse data both categories crave. The unrestricted access means organizations can uncover trends and make predictions that were previously out of reach if they stuck to structured methods.

Final Thoughts: Embracing the Future of Data Management

As you step back to gaze at the data landscape, one thing becomes abundantly clear: data lakes are here to stay. They're not just trendy tools for modern businesses but rather essential components driving innovation and optimization. The sheer capability of these lakes to hold loads of raw data until it’s required opens up endless possibilities.

So next time you think about data management, consider how data lakes fit into the grand scheme of things. They’re not just reservoirs; they symbolize the future of how we interact with data. With the right strategies in place, organizations can transform oceans of unrefined data into actionable insights, ultimately steering their success.

And who knows? Maybe one day you’ll find yourself exploring a data lake, discovering treasures that reshape how your organization approaches its challenges. Isn’t that an exciting thought?

Subscribe

Get the latest from Examzify

You can unsubscribe at any time. Read our privacy policy